About Brandon Corbett

Brandon Corbett is a scholar working on Control and Systems Engineering, Molecular Biology, Public Health, Environmental and Occupational Health, Modeling and Simulation and Biomedical Engineering, having authored 43 papers that have together received 825 indexed citations. Recurring topics across this work include Advanced Control Systems Optimization (25 papers), Fault Detection and Control Systems (21 papers), Control Systems and Identification (12 papers), Mathematical and Theoretical Epidemiology and Ecology Models (5 papers), Analytical Chemistry and Chromatography (3 papers), Spectroscopy and Chemometric Analyses (3 papers), Process Optimization and Integration (3 papers) and Microfluidic and Capillary Electrophoresis Applications (3 papers). The work is most often cited by research in Modeling and Simulation (86 citations), Control and Systems Engineering (361 citations), Molecular Medicine (48 citations), Biomaterials (101 citations) and Numerical Analysis (30 citations). Brandon Corbett has collaborated with scholars based in Canada, United States and Sweden. Frequent co-authors include Prashant Mhaskar, Seyed M. Moghadas, Murray E. Alexander, Todd Hoare, Emily D. Cranston, Abba B. Gumel, Kevin J. De France, Kevin G. Yager, E. E. Pochin and Abhinav Garg. Their work appears in journals such as Computers & Chemical Engineering, Industrial & Engineering Chemistry Research, AIChE Journal, The Canadian Journal of Chemical Engineering and IEEE Transactions on Control Systems Technology.
